The Kaltura Media Assignment activity allows students to submit a video directly to you for grading. The media can be either a pre-recorded, edited video (.mov, mp4) or an instantly-recorded video using Kaltura Express Capture or the Kaltura Capture App. CreateGradeCreate You can create a Kaltura Media Assignment much like any other Activity in Moodle. Workshops are a Moodle activity which is highly customizable and thus takes a comparatively high amount of setup but facilitates peer review within a class. This activity features: Two grading values: student submissions as well as peer review Multiple Phases of activity function: Setup, Submission, Assessment, Grading Evaluation, and Closed. The Database activity allows the teacher and/or students to build, display and search a bank of record entries about any conceivable topic. The format and structure of these entries can be almost unlimited, including images, files, URLs, numbers and text amongst other things.

The Q&A Forum requires students to reply to the question/prompt before they can see other responses (with a 15-minute delay). The Q&A Forum also requires the instructor to make an initial post every term before it can be used by students.
